
Wouldn’t it be so disappointing if Lady Gaga’s new music video for her song “G.U.Y.” wasn’t a maelstrom of utterly strange imagery and even stranger costumes, replete with cameos from Bravo stars?
On Saturday, the pop singer debuted her latest video on NBC’s Dateline before making it available online. And when it comes to bizarreness, the nearly 12-minute clip is solidly Gaga-esque. The video for the song — whose title is an acronym for Girl Under You — opens with the pop singer facedown in a ditch as some kind of woman-bird hybrid with an arrow in her back. From there, as the film unfolds, things only become more peculiar.
